Open Water Diving Course from Marseille Provence Diving

Program Description:

 

  • 2 Knowledge Development sessions.
  • 6 Scuba dives in open water.

The PADI Open Water Course is certifiable, enabling the qualified diver to charter dive boats, hire diving equipment, as well as acting as a platform for further diving qualifications. The course structure is based on performance, not time, which enables any person who may encounter difficulties with any aspect of the course, the opportunity to overcome these in their own time, with extra tuition from an instructor.

The PADI Open Water Diver certification qualifies you to:

 

  • Dive independently (with a certified diving buddy) while applying the knowledge and skills that you learned in this course, within the limits of your dive training and experience. You shall be licensed to dive to a depth of 18 meters.
  • Procure air fills, scuba equipment and other service for scuba diving.
  • Plan, conduct and log open water no stop (no decompression) dives when equipped properly and accompanied by a buddy in conditions which you have training and or experience.
  • Continue your diver training with a specialty dive in the PADI Advanced Open Water program, and or in PADI specialty course.
